Safe Use of Chain Blocks Ensuring Efficiency and Safety in Lifting Operations
Chain blocks, also known as chain hoists or lever hoists, are essential tools in industries that involve lifting heavy loads. When used correctly, these devices can significantly enhance efficiency and safety in various settings, from construction sites to warehouses. However, improper use can lead to accidents, injuries, and equipment damage. Therefore, understanding the safe use of chain blocks is paramount for anyone involved in lifting operations.
Understanding Chain Blocks
A chain block consists of a chain, pulley, and a lifting mechanism. The chain is pulled to lift a load, which can be a heavy object or machinery. The design allows for significant mechanical advantage, making it easier to lift heavy weights with minimal effort. However, the effectiveness of a chain block depends on its proper use, maintenance, and adherence to safety standards.
Key Safety Guidelines
1. Choosing the Right Chain Block Before using a chain block, it's crucial to select the appropriate model for the task. The chain block's capacity should exceed the weight of the load being lifted. Overloading a chain block can cause it to fail, resulting in dangerous situations.
2. Regular Inspections All chain blocks should be inspected regularly for wear and tear. Key components such as the hooks, chains, and lifting mechanisms should be checked for any signs of damage or stress. Any defective equipment should be replaced immediately to avoid accidents.
3. Training and Competency Users of chain blocks must be adequately trained in their operation. Knowledge of the equipment's specifics, including load limits and proper rigging techniques, is essential. Employers should ensure that all personnel are familiar with safe lifting practices.
4. Proper Rigging Techniques The effectiveness and safety of a chain block depend largely on how loads are rigged. Use appropriate slings or shackles to secure the load, ensuring that the weight is evenly distributed. Avoid using makeshift rigging solutions that may compromise safety.
5. Clear Work Area Before initiating a lift, ensure that the surrounding area is clear of obstacles and personnel. Establish a designated work zone to keep onlookers at a safe distance. Communicate clearly with team members, using hand signals or radios when necessary.
6. Load Stability When lifting, be aware of the load’s stability. Unevenly distributed weight or loose materials can shift during lifting, leading to hazards. Ensure the load is secured and stable before attempting to lift.
7. Environmental Factors Pay attention to environmental conditions that could affect the lifting operation. Wind, rain, or extreme temperatures can influence both the equipment’s performance and the safety of personnel. Adjust operations accordingly, postponing lifts in adverse weather conditions.
8. Emergency Procedures Having a plan in place for emergencies is crucial. Ensure that all team members understand the steps to take in case of an equipment failure or an accident. This includes having access to first aid and emergency contact numbers.
